Egypt receives rare international rebuke for human rights violations

Egypt receives rare international rebuke for human rights violations Borzou Daragahi © Provided by The Independent More than 30 nations on Friday signed on a scathing condemnation of Egypt’s record of human rights abuses under rule of President Abdel-Fattah el-Sisi, a staunch partner of the west and an enthusiastic customer of its weapons. The statement, issued during the ongoing session of the United Nations Human Rights Council, urged Egypt to halt repression of human rights and civil society activists, dissidents, lawyers, critics and LGBTI individuals, many of them persecuted under the blanket excuse of fighting terrorism. Among those signing the statement were the United States, United Kingdom, France, Germany and Italy. These western states are key economic and military partners of Mr Sisi’s Cairo regime, which came to power nearly eight years ago after toppling the country’s first freely elected president.
